Output ebf504f370d7e58fd71ee7d8f85e5c93e8e1eed3e92b598e31bc2f88fea59347:11

value
1303900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a90163ddf30c80d44a23cf3465782bab453eb24 OP_EQUAL
address
3BQUAD86MuofWsHZZL7MqbAm1TZYFdBUFw
transaction
ebf504f370d7e58fd71ee7d8f85e5c93e8e1eed3e92b598e31bc2f88fea59347
confirmations
276677
spent
true